When wind turbines are arranged in clusters, their performance is mutually affected, and their energy generation is reduced relative to what it would be if they were widely separated. Land-area power densities of small wind farms can exceed 10 W/m2, and wakes are several rotor diameters in length. Luxembourg has announced a comprehensive package of 51 measures to promote renewable energy and enhance energy efficiency, aiming to significantly cut emissions and reduce its reliance on fossil fuels. Indeed, Luxembourg must aim to cover 100% of its final energy consumption from renewable sources. A portable energy storage power supply, often referred to as a portable power station, is a compact device that stores electrical energy in rechargeable batteries. It can supply power to various electronic devices such as smartphones, laptops, lights, and even small appliances.
